6.0.0-git
2019-04-21

[#1922] End of Month Recurrence
Summary End of Month Recurrence
Queue Kronolith
Queue Version Git master
Type Enhancement
State Resolved
Priority 1. Low
Owners jan (at) horde (dot) org
Requester awillis (at) nweci (dot) org
Created 2005-05-06 (5098 days ago)
Due
Updated 2015-05-21 (1431 days ago)
Assigned
Resolved 2015-05-21 (1431 days ago)
Milestone 5
Patch No

History
2015-05-21 11:01:59 Jan Schneider Comment #16
Assigned to Jan Schneider
State ⇒ Resolved
Version ⇒ Git master
Milestone ⇒ 5
Reply to this comment
Implemented in Kronolith 5 and Nag 5.
2015-03-27 09:18:28 jordi (dot) collado (at) upcnet (dot) es Comment #15 Reply to this comment
We are interested in the feature of the last x weekday in a month.
2014-02-04 22:42:58 samuel (dot) wolf (at) wolf-maschinenbau (dot) de Comment #14 Reply to this comment
Wow, 3200 days since the request and ist not realized! Is horde 
developing soo slowly? We plan to use it in our group, and i think 
this request is a basic feature in a calendar.
Feel free to sponsor it like we does on some features!
Personal we do not need such a feature.
2014-02-03 14:25:03 my (dot) kron (at) gmx (dot) de Comment #13 Reply to this comment
Wow, 3200 days since the request and ist not realized! Is horde 
developing soo slowly? We plan to use it in our group, and i think 
this request is a basic feature in a calendar.

2007-12-28 23:08:01 Chuck Hagenbuch Comment #12
State ⇒ Accepted
Reply to this comment
This should still be an open feature request.
2007-12-28 23:07:38 Chuck Hagenbuch State ⇒ No Feedback
 
2007-12-05 10:34:07 Jan Schneider Comment #11 Reply to this comment
Are you going to improve the patch?
2007-11-20 14:37:32 Jan Schneider Comment #10 Reply to this comment
I don't know what this patch is going to calculate but definitely not 
the "last x in month" recurrence rule. I assumed it would calculate 
the last x weekday in a month, but even if it's supposed to calculate 
the last x day in a month, it's completely off.
2007-10-28 23:58:27 Chuck Hagenbuch Deleted Original Message
 
2007-10-27 21:51:40 horde (at) duffeaap (dot) com Comment #9
New Attachment: patch_1922.patch Download
Reply to this comment
My bad. This should be alright.
2007-10-27 21:25:31 Jan Schneider Comment #8
State ⇒ Feedback
Reply to this comment
Please provide your patch as a single unified diff patch.
2007-10-27 15:50:09 horde (at) duffeaap (dot) com Comment #7
New Attachment: patch_1922.zip
Reply to this comment
I basically copied Chuck's code for the MONTHLY_DATE and adjusted 
somewhat. It might be possible to make it more concise.



It, however, works fine for SQL.

I have no way to test Kolab backend, so I'm not sure how that works.



Also the vCal and iCal imports for this recurrence are not available. 
The problem is that there is no code in those which will make it easy 
to extract the "EndOfMonth" data.

I noticed that is also missing for the YEARLY_WEEKDAY case.



Maybe someone can give me some hints or finish that part off, if necessary.
2007-03-15 15:18:44 Chuck Hagenbuch Comment #6
Version ⇒ HEAD
Reply to this comment
It's a new feature, not a bug, though I'm sure that it would be useful 
to a lot of people. I'm not aware of it being a priority for any 
developers at the moment, but if you want to contribute a patch, or to 
sponsor a bounty for it, that would certainly speed it up.
2007-03-15 11:42:13 jochem (at) mondrian (dot) nl Comment #5 Reply to this comment
Is there any chance of this bug being resolved in the near future? I 
think there's a decent number of people affected by this that just 
don't come forward.
2005-05-25 17:04:01 Chuck Hagenbuch Summary ⇒ End of Month Recurrence
 
2005-05-07 13:43:28 Chuck Hagenbuch Comment #4 Reply to this comment
You'll need to add a new KRONOLITH_RECUR_ constant to 
lib/Kronolith.php, implement handling of it in all of the places that 
we look at recurrence type, and make sure that all of the Driver/ 
backends support it.
2005-05-07 05:05:53 awillis (at) nweci (dot) org Comment #3 Reply to this comment
I consider myself very well versed in php, but I"m not really familiar 
with the Horde  framework.



Could you maybe point me in the right direction?
2005-05-07 04:04:40 Chuck Hagenbuch Comment #2
State ⇒ Accepted
Reply to this comment
Yes. A patch would greatly speed it up, though, or perhaps a bounty.
2005-05-06 22:59:57 awillis (at) nweci (dot) org Comment #1
Type ⇒ Enhancement
State ⇒ New
Priority ⇒ 1. Low
Summary ⇒ End of Month Recurrence?
Queue ⇒ Kronolith
Reply to this comment
Would it be possible to add in a type of Recurrence that happens at 
the end of every month?



Thanks,

~drew

Saved Queries